Raipur - Ramsanehighat, Bara Banki
Raipur is a village situated in the Ramsanehighat tehsil of Bara Banki district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 5 km from the tehsil headquarters in Ramsanehighat and around 42 km from the district headquarters in Barabanki. Muraarpur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Raipur village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Raipur is 165081. The village covers a total geographical area of 60.55 hectares and falls under the 225404 pincode. Barabanki is the nearest town, located about 7 km away.
Raipur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Dariyabad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Faizabad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Raipur
As per Census 2011, Raipur village has a total population of 176 people, consisting of 98 males and 78 females. The village has 36 households and a sex ratio of 795 females per 1,000 males. There are 23 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 100 literate and 76 illiterate residents. Additionally, 79 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
